|
Revenues - Deferred Income Activity (Details) - USD ($)
$ in Thousands
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2021
|
Sep. 30, 2020
|
Sep. 30, 2021
|
Sep. 30, 2020
|Deferred Revenue and Contract Balances
|Beginning balance
|$ 19,663
|$ 20,237
|$ 21,359
|$ 13,280
|Increases to deferred income
|5,154
|10,786
|15,373
|22,457
|Recognition of revenue
|(5,335)
|(5,802)
|(17,250)
|(10,516)
|Ending balance
|19,482
|25,221
|19,482
|25,221
|Revenue recognized
|5,335
|5,802
|17,250
|10,516
|Advisory services fees
|Deferred Revenue and Contract Balances
|Recognition of revenue
|(512)
|(554)
|(1,600)
|(1,700)
|Revenue recognized
|512
|554
|1,600
|1,700
|Audio visual
|Deferred Revenue and Contract Balances
|Recognition of revenue
|(296)
|(458)
|(1,500)
|(1,600)
|Revenue recognized
|296
|458
|1,500
|1,600
|Other revenue
|Deferred Revenue and Contract Balances
|Recognition of revenue
|(2,300)
|(4,000)
|(8,900)
|(5,400)
|Revenue recognized
|2,300
|4,000
|8,900
|5,400
|Cumulative catch-up adjustment to revenue
|1,300
|1,100
|Other services
|Deferred Revenue and Contract Balances
|Recognition of revenue
|(2,200)
|(773)
|(5,300)
|(1,900)
|Revenue recognized
|$ 2,200
|$ 773
|$ 5,300
|$ 1,900
|X
- Definition
+ References
Contract With Customer, Liability, Additions And Revenue Recognized
+ Details
No definition available.
|X
- Definition
+ References
Contract with Customer, Liability Activity [Roll Forward]
+ Details
No definition available.
|X
- Definition
+ References
Amount of obligation to transfer good or service to customer for which consideration has been received or is receivable.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of increase (decrease) in revenue recognized for cumulative catch-up adjustment from change in measure of progress which (increases) decreases obligation to transfer good or service to customer for which consideration from customer has been received or is due.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of increase (decrease) in revenue recognized for cumulative catch-up adjustment from contract modification which (increases) decreases obligation to transfer good or service to customer for which consideration from customer has been received or is due.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details